Output 59ae698752acb147adedbbcdf0b2c3abacc3dc2245da97359904869b95def31e:0

value
238005904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45642a3967d21ef890817a3c81607575aba66dcd OP_EQUAL
address
381vYMwyJznLVaaEMq1R5RRpjrqFLiLfkV
transaction
59ae698752acb147adedbbcdf0b2c3abacc3dc2245da97359904869b95def31e
spent
true